Valley Bank names 10-year veteran as president

Tom Iadanza.

Wayne-based Valley National Bank said Thursday it elevated Thomas Iadanza to president. A 10-year veteran at Valley, Iadanza was most recently senior executive vice president, chief banking officer.

In this new role, Iadanza will oversee the bank’s day-to-day operations, including commercial banking, retail banking, digital products, credit, customer experience and financial services.

“Tom is an exceptional leader who has played an integral role in Valley’s growth,” said Ira Robbins, who will remain CEO. “As we continue to expand our capabilities, services and footprint, Tom will drive these efforts and ensure we maintain true to our culture of a relationship bank that delivers service-based results.”

“I am honored that Ira and the board have put their trust in me to help lead Valley forward,” Iadanaza stated. “During Ira’s tenure as president and CEO, we’ve grown from a bank with approximately $20 billion in assets to one approaching $50 billion with a focused growth plan in place. I am confident that we have the right people and vision to make Valley one of the premiere commercial banks in the country, and I couldn’t be more excited about our future.”
